4. Prioritize Data Privacy and Compliance

  • Encrypt all voice data in transit and at rest using industry-standard protocols such as AES-256.
  • Enforce strict access controls, role-based permissions, and maintain detailed audit logs for all data interactions.
  • Collaborate with legal and compliance experts to ensure full adherence to HIPAA and other confidentiality regulations.

5. Integrate with Existing Case Management Systems

  • Use robust APIs to connect your voice assistant with popular platforms like Clio, MyCase, and PracticePanther.
  • Ensure seamless synchronization of legal and medical records to prevent data silos and maintain workflow continuity.

Comparison Table: Leading Voice Recognition Tools for Legal-Medical Use

Tool Strengths Weaknesses Ideal Use Case
Google Speech-to-Text High accuracy, customizable models, real-time transcription Complex pricing, setup for domain adaptation Accurate recognition in specialized fields
IBM Watson Speech to Text Strong privacy controls, flexible APIs Steeper learning curve, smaller community HIPAA-compliant voice applications
Microsoft Azure Speech Robust AI features, seamless Microsoft ecosystem integration Less flexible outside Microsoft stack Integration in Microsoft-based legal workflows
